Short version of the story: I purchased a Samsung DLP HDTV online, standard 12 month warranty. Came straight from Korea. 14 months after my purchase it starts having huge problems. A quarter of the screen had different colors then the other 75%.

I called Samsung, they apologized profusely, extended my warranty by 6 months, and a guy repaired it today. He left 5 minutes ago.

Two companies who have treated me like a king: Samsung and Lenovo

Too many people write about poor service, I want to give a huge thanks to Samsung and have no problem recommending their HDTV’s to my friends and family.
